DE18 WTT is a 2018 Audi Tt in Grey with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2018 Audi Tt models, the average MOT pass rate is 91.2% with a typical mileage of 31,153 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Audi Tt f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 59,061 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DE18 WTT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i Tt typ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 8 years old, this Audi Tt is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
